Biodegradable Biopolymer Container
Product Description
'Capers' use biodegradable biopolymer containers at its salad bars and various other areas. They are made from 'Nature Works PLA' and Capers collect customers' used containers in-store and send them for industrial composting.
Retail outlet
Capers, British Columbia

Comments / Considerations
Disposal routes - need to help consumers note the difference between conventional and bio-polymer plastic containers.
Added Value
The biopolymer containers cost Capers slightly less than their previous PET containers, because the previous containers were a higher guage and more expensive than most supermarkets' containers.
